Well, it is not necessarily bad to get a car from an independant store. But, if you have extensive car repair / maintenance knowledge, so by inspecting the car and test drive it, you can spot most of the issues if there is any. It would also be a good idea to take the car to another repair shop to have it inspected.
 
Buying a car is like an investment (especially used cars). If you want to get a better deal, you most probably will assume higher risk. The chance of getting a better deal depends on your luck and knowledge - just like when buying stocks.
 
On the other hand, if you buy it from dealership, you can be rest assured that the car will be in very good shape and most probably will be backed by the dealership in case anything goes wrong. If it were me, I would try negotiate a good deal from the infiniti dealer (Maybe get an extended warranty at a discount price). It is a luxury car and it is worth to pay a little bit extra to get the peace of mind when you drive it hard or relaxed, IMO.

I was quoted $36,000 for for '08 M35x Base car no nav. Instead I bought a moonlight white with black interior for '08 M35x with tech package, 15K miles and in mint condition for $31K. If you do not need AWD I have seen used 35X for $26-$28K. Good luck. I bought mine 2 weeks ago and I LOVE it.
